- The distance between Ras Elnakb, Egypt and Park Rapids, Mn, Usa is approximately 10,136 km or 6,298 mi.
- To reach Ras Elnakb in this distance one would set out from Park Rapids, Mn bearing 41.9° or NE and follow the great circles arc to approach Ras Elnakb bearing 148.3° or SSE .
- Ras Elnakb has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h) whereas Park Rapids, Mn has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b).
- Ras Elnakb is in or near the subtropical desert biome whereas Park Rapids, Mn is in or near the boreal wet forest biome.
- The mean temperature is 15.3 °C (27.5°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 18.3 °C (32.9°F) less in Ras Elnakb.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to truly continental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 648.7 mm (25.5 in) less which is equivalent to 648.7 l/m² (15.92 US gal/ft²) or 6,487,000 l/ha (693,503 US gal/ac) less. About 0 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 17.3° higher in Ras Elnakb than in Park Rapids, Mn.
